(IraqiNews.com) al-Anbar – The commander of Anbar Operations Command, Maj. Gen. Ismail al-Mahalawi, announced on Tuesday, that the international coalition aviation has managed to destroy eight booby-trapped vehicles west of Fallujah.

Mahalawi, in a statement issued to the media, said, “The international coalition aviation, in coordination with a unit of Anbar Operations, managed to bombard eight booby-trapped vehicles of ISIS which were driven by suicide bombers at al-Halabsa west of Fallujah,” adding, “The bombing resulted in the destruction of the booby-trapped vehicles and killing all the suicide bombers inside.”

“The vehicles were attempting to target the troops which were heading towards to liberate al-Halabsa and Albu Elwan from ISIS grip,” Mahalawi added.
